How to Apply for Texas ID Online: A Step-by-Step Guide

Definition & Meaning of Texas ID

A Texas ID refers to a state-issued identification card that serves as an official form of identification for residents. It is primarily used by individuals who do not possess a driver’s license but require a valid ID for various purposes, such as voting, traveling, or verifying identity. The Texas ID is recognized throughout the United States and is essential for accessing certain services, including banking and healthcare.

The Texas identification card is issued by the Texas Department of Public Safety (DPS) and is available to residents of all ages. It is particularly useful for minors or those who do not drive. The card includes personal details such as the holder's name, date of birth, and a photograph, ensuring it meets federal identification standards.

Required Documents for Texas ID Application

To apply for a Texas ID online, specific documents are necessary to verify your identity and residency. These documents include:

  • Proof of Identity: This can be a birth certificate, U.S. passport, or military ID.
  • Proof of Residency: Acceptable documents include utility bills, bank statements, or lease agreements showing your name and address.
  • Social Security Number: You may need to provide your Social Security card or another document that verifies your SSN.

It is essential to ensure that all documents are current and valid. If you are applying for a replacement Texas driver’s license or ID due to loss or theft, you may need to provide additional documentation, such as a police report.

Steps to Apply for Texas ID Online

The process to apply for a Texas ID online is straightforward. Follow these steps to ensure a smooth application:

  • Visit the Texas DPS Website: Navigate to the official DPS website to access the online application portal.
  • Complete the Application: Fill out the online form with your personal information, including your name, address, and date of birth.
  • Upload Required Documents: Scan and upload the necessary documents as specified in the application.
  • Pay the Fee: There is a nominal fee for obtaining a Texas ID, which can be paid online using a credit or debit card.
  • Submit Your Application: Review your information for accuracy and submit the application.

After submission, you will receive a confirmation email with details about your application status and estimated processing time.

Who Typically Uses the Texas ID?

The Texas ID is commonly used by various individuals, including:

  • Minors: Young individuals who do not yet have a driver’s license but need identification for school or travel.
  • Non-Drivers: Adults who do not drive but require a valid form of ID for identification purposes.
  • Individuals Replacing Lost Licenses: Those who have lost their driver’s license and need immediate identification.

Additionally, the Texas ID can be beneficial for individuals who may not have other forms of identification, ensuring they can access essential services and activities.

Application Process & Approval Time

The application process for obtaining a Texas ID online typically takes between two to four weeks for processing. Factors that can influence the approval time include:

  • Volume of Applications: High application volumes may lead to longer processing times.
  • Document Verification: Ensuring all submitted documents are valid can speed up the process.
  • Application Completeness: Incomplete applications may require additional time for resolution.

Applicants can check their application status through the DPS website to stay informed about their ID’s processing timeline.
